Output 31fffa37be0970e919e153929a9afc6dd8efc705a1d4bf443e58fba54ee368a1:17

value
2776314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e2a0ee8da5643cd139785b5c000111f02a37f2d OP_EQUAL
address
3G7K57NoD7EZ89W7FABbrPiKZDbkCkRPvw
transaction
31fffa37be0970e919e153929a9afc6dd8efc705a1d4bf443e58fba54ee368a1
confirmations
149354
spent
true